- 博客(17)
- 资源 (3)
- 收藏
- 关注
转载 java中异常抛出后代码还会继续执行吗?
本博文为转载博文,原文地址今天遇到一个问题,在下面的代码中,当抛出运行时异常后,后面的代码还会执行吗,是否需要在异常后面加上return语句呢? @Override public void registerObserver(Observer o) { if (o == null){ throw new Exception("o i...
2018-05-16 11:26:27
18497
原创 File类中的list()和listFiles()方法
本博文为阅读笔记,供个人查阅复习用list()方法是返回某个目录下的所有文件和目录的文件名,返回的是String数组; File mFile = new File("F:\\Book"); System.out.println("this is File.list() : " + mFile.list()); for (String ...
2018-05-15 20:34:06
1600
原创 Promise对象
本博文为阅读笔记,供个人查阅复习用。1、Promise 的含义Promise 是异步编程的一种解决方案,比传统的解决方案——回调函数和事件——更合理和更强大。所谓Promise,简单说就是一个容器,里面保存着某个未来才会结束的事件(通常是一个异步操作)的结果。从语法上说,Promise 是一个对象,从它可以获取异步操作的消息。Promise 提供统一的 API,各种异步操作都可...
2018-05-11 11:43:07
192
原创 Set 和 Map 数据结构
本博文为阅读笔记,供个人复习备忘用。一、Set的基本用法ES6 提供了新的数据结构 Set。它类似于数组,但是成员的值都是唯一的,没有重复的值。Set 本身是一个构造函数,用来生成 Set 数据结构。const arr = new Set();let nums = [1, 2, 4, 3, 4, 2, 3, 2];nums.forEach((x) =>...
2018-05-10 14:45:04
285
原创 正则表达式学习资料
本博文为正则表达式学习的网上资源,供个人复习备忘用正则表达式学习网上资源正则表达式手册正则表达式在线测试工具正则表达式30分钟入门教程正则表达式语言 - 快速参考...
2018-04-25 20:38:20
133
原创 TypeScript数据类型
本博文为阅读笔记,供个人复习备忘用数据类型TypeScript 中的数据类型有Undefined、Number(数值类型)、string(字符串类型)、Boolean(布尔类型)、enum(枚举类型)、any(任意类型)、void(空类型)、Array(数组类型)、Tuple(元祖类型)、Null(空类型)。JavaScript 中的数据类型有Undefined、Numbe...
2018-04-21 17:09:51
5859
1
原创 认识 TypeScript 语言
此博文为阅读笔记,供个人复习备忘用1、认识 TypeScriptTypeScript 是一种由微软开发的自由和开源的编程语言。它是 JavaScript 的一个超集,TypeScript 在 JavaScript 的基础上添加了可选的静态类型和基于类的面向对象编程。TypeScript会在编译时期去掉数据类型和特有语法,生成纯粹的 JavaScript 代码。由于最终在浏览器上...
2018-04-19 17:41:22
966
转载 JavaScript中双叹号(!!)作用
经常看到这样的例子:var a;var b=!!a;a默认是undefined。!a是true,!!a则是false,所以b的值是false,而不再是undefined,也非其它值,主要是为后续判断提供便利。!!一般用来将后面的表达式强制转换为布尔类型的数据(boolean),也就是只能是true或者false; 因为javascript是弱类型的语言(变量没有固定的数据类型)...
2018-04-12 11:29:12
7095
原创 Android 活动的启动模式
本博文为《Android群英传》阅读笔记,供个人备完用。1、活动的四种启动模式Android开发者在AndroidMainifest文件中一共设计了四种启动模式,如下所示。standard singleTopsingleTasksingleInstance
2017-10-24 17:06:19
250
原创 Android 动画的简单使用——视图动画
本博文为《Android群英传》阅读笔记,供个人备忘用。 一、视图动画概述视图动画使用简单,效果丰富,它提供了AlphaAnimation、RotateAnimation、TranslateAni-mation、ScaleAnimation四种动画方式,并提供了AnimationSet动画集合,混合使用多种动画。在Android 3.0之前,视图动画一家独大,但随着Android 3.0之后属性动
2017-10-20 12:42:55
325
转载 NestedScrollView+RecyclerView优雅的解决滑动冲突问题
NestedScrollView+RecyclerView优雅的解决滑动冲突问题
2017-08-15 17:09:19
2234
原创 (第二行代码阅读笔记)活动(Activity)的生命周期
活动(Activity)的生命周期 1、活动的状态 1、运行状态:当一个活动位于返回栈顶时,这时活动就处于运行状态。系统最不愿意回收的就是运行状态的活动。2、暂停状态:当一个活动不再处于栈顶位置,但仍然可见时,这是活动就进入了暂停状态。3、停止状态:当一个活动不再处于栈顶位置,并且完全不可见的时候,就进入了停止状态。4、销毁状态:当一个活动从返回栈中移除后就变成了销毁状态。2、活动的生存期
2017-06-07 23:22:17
627
Android 动画的简单实用——视图动画
2017-10-20
Android启动页与引导页的简单实现
2017-10-11
空空如也
TA创建的收藏夹 TA关注的收藏夹
TA关注的人